Tomasz Stefaniak is a scholar working on Surgery, Physiology and Endocrinology, Diabetes and Metabolism. According to data from OpenAlex, Tomasz Stefaniak has authored 83 papers receiving a total of 965 ind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Surgery, 18 papers in Physiology and 11 papers in Endocrinology, Diabetes and Metabolism. Recurrent topics in Tomasz Stefaniak's work include Bariatric Surgery and Outcomes (12 papers), Sympathectomy and Hyperhidrosis Treatments (11 papers) and Diabetes Treatment and Management (7 papers). Tomasz Stefaniak is often cited by papers focused on Bariatric Surgery and Outcomes (12 papers), Sympathectomy and Hyperhidrosis Treatments (11 papers) and Diabetes Treatment and Management (7 papers). Tomasz Stefaniak collaborates with scholars based in Poland, Netherlands and United Kingdom. Tomasz Stefaniak's co-authors include Zbigniew Śledziński, Łukasz Kaska, Jarek Kobiela, Andrzej J. Łachiński, Monika Proczko, Wojciech Makarewicz, Tomasz Śledziński, Julian Świerczyński, A.J.J.M. Vingerhoets and Andrzej Basiński and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Chemical & Engineering Data and BMJ Open.
